Transaction 02a045fa102e77bdc6b891861a308546bfb83c88dd77bc07fa30357c47270852
2 Input
2 Outputs
- 02a045fa102e77bdc6b891861a308546bfb83c88dd77bc07fa30357c47270852:0
- 02a045fa102e77bdc6b891861a308546bfb83c88dd77bc07fa30357c47270852:1
value 424200
address 15LwXeUwWzohgEbwMjQQc2UWSA3LmzZq7p
value 29977380
address 3CMCABMi2WgthnqzGcLkeR5Rq2BzyRmvjw